THE POWER OF EMOTIONAL SELFAWARENESS IN SEXUAL RELATIONSHIPS HOW TO IMPROVE YOUR LOVE LIFE THROUGH BETTER COMMUNICATION

Emotional self-awareness is an essential component of a person's ability to form healthy, fulfilling sexual relationships. It involves being aware of one's own feelings, thoughts, and behaviors and how they impact others. People who lack this awareness may struggle to understand their needs, communicate effectively, and maintain boundaries. In contrast, individuals with high levels of emotional intelligence can recognize and manage their emotions, leading to greater empathy and understanding in their partnerships.

The importance of emotional self-awareness in sexual relationships cannot be overstated. Without it, people may experience difficulties communicating their desires and limitations, which can lead to misunderstandings, frustration, and resentment. They may also struggle to handle conflicts and disagreements, potentially damaging the relationship beyond repair. On the other hand, those who are emotionally self-aware are better equipped to navigate challenges and find solutions that work for both parties involved.

A couple who lacks emotional self-awareness may find themselves arguing about trivial matters repeatedly, leading to resentment and contempt.

If one partner has a higher level of self-awareness, they may recognize when their behavior or attitude is causing conflict and take steps to change it. This can significantly improve the dynamic between them and make communication easier.

In addition to resolving conflicts, emotional self-awareness can help partners establish trust and intimacy. By recognizing their own emotions and expressing them openly and honestly, they build a foundation of mutual respect and vulnerability. This allows for deeper connection and greater emotional safety, essential for creating a stable, fulfilling sexual relationship.

Emotional self-awareness plays a crucial role in forming healthy, fulfilling sexual relationships. Individuals who lack this ability may struggle to communicate effectively, understand their needs, manage conflicts, and create intimacy. Those with high levels of emotional intelligence, on the other hand, are more likely to have successful and satisfying romantic connections.

How does emotional self-awareness influence a person's ability to form stable, fulfilling sexual relationships?

Self-awareness refers to one's understanding of their feelings, thoughts, behaviors, strengths, weaknesses, goals, values, beliefs, and motivations (Cherry, 2019). Emotional self-awareness is part of this broad concept, but it focuses on how individuals are aware of their emotions and the impact they have on their behavior, perceptions, and decisions.
